Public Wi-Fi Is Convenient, but Do You Know Who Is Around You?

Free Wi-Fi can be difficult to resist. Airports, hotels, cafés, libraries, shopping centres, convention halls, and other public places make it easy to open a laptop or phone and get back online within minutes.

The convenience of that connectivity is enjoyable when needed, but there is something that can easily be overlooked: you may know very little or nothing about the network you’ve just joined, nor anything about the other people using that network alongside you.

Poorly secured wireless networks, deceptive hotspots made to look like legitimate ones, and certain forms of network snooping or traffic manipulation can create opportunities for information to be observed or redirected. HTTPS has made ordinary web browsing considerably safer, but it does not make every situation absolutely safe.

When connecting to public Wi-Fi, there can still be risks from wrongdoers attempting to intercept information or manipulate traffic, particularly on poorly secured or deceptive networks. Passwords, banking information, and other sensitive personal data deserve particular caution. Nevertheless, an unfamiliar network introduces another element into your online activity: a network structure that you simply do not control

A VPN Is a Strong Layered Lock, Not the Only Lock

There is still no single button that makes banking, shopping, payments, or account logins completely safe. Strong and unique passwords remain important. Multi-factor authentication adds another barrier. Secure banking apps and HTTPS matter. Devices and browsers should be kept current, and suspicious links or unexpected login requests deserve caution.

This additional layer belongs alongside those precautions rather than replacing them. When sensitive information is involved, several sensible safeguards working together are far more useful than depending on one technology to do everything.

3. A Worldwide Network Gives You More Ways to Connect

Woman using a laptop with a worldwide VPN network connecting servers across multiple countries

One of the practical advantages of a large server network is choice. Instead of relying on a single route, users can connect through servers in different regions depending on where they are located and what they are doing.

That can matter while traveling, working remotely, or simply trying to establish a dependable connection through a nearby server. A broader network also gives the service more flexibility when individual locations become busy.

It is worth remembering that distance still matters. Connecting through a server relatively close to your physical location will often provide better performance than routing traffic halfway around the world without a reason.

For everyday users, the important point is not memorizing server numbers. It is having enough locations available that the service can remain useful whether you are at home, traveling, working from another city, or connecting from another country.

5. Protection Should Follow You From Device to Device

Woman using a laptop, smartphone, and tablet protected by a VPN across multiple devices

Internet activity no longer happens on one computer. A typical day may involve a desktop or laptop, a smartphone, a tablet, and perhaps additional connected devices around the home.

That makes device support more important than it once was. NordVPN currently allows up to 10 devices to be connected simultaneously under one account, covering common platforms such as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, and iOS.

For households with even more connected equipment, a compatible router can also be configured to provide encrypted connections. The router occupies one device slot while helping cover equipment connected through that network, although router configuration requires more technical setup than installing the ordinary application.

The practical benefit is consistency. Privacy protection does considerably less good if it exists only on the computer at home while the phone, tablet, or travel laptop is routinely used elsewhere without it.

A Few More VPN Tools Worth Knowing About

Woman using VPN tools including Double VPN, Dedicated IP, Mesh-Net, obfuscated connections, and Dark Web Monitor

Some features are designed for particular situations rather than everyday browsing. Obfuscated connections can be useful on networks where ordinary VPN traffic is restricted. Double VPN adds another routing layer for users who want it. Dedicated IP addresses are available separately for people or businesses that benefit from having a consistent IP address.

NordVPN also provides features such as Meshnet and Dark Web Monitor. Meshnet can create private connections between supported devices, while Dark Web Monitor is intended to alert users when account information associated with an email address appears in known data leaks.

These are useful additions, but they should remain in perspective. The strongest reason to use a VPN is still the basic job it performs: protecting network traffic and giving the user more control over how that traffic reaches the internet.

Where a VPN Fits Into the Bigger Picture

Layered online security showing VPN protection alongside strong passwords, multi-factor authentication, updates, and safe browsing habits

A VPN is best understood as one layer in a broader approach to online security. It cannot prevent every scam, stop every phishing attempt, repair a compromised password, or make unsafe behavior harmless.

Strong passwords, multi-factor authentication, software updates, secure websites, careful account management, reputable security tools, and healthy skepticism toward suspicious messages still matter.

The encrypted connection protects something different: the route carrying your traffic. When that connection matters—as it often does during travel, public Wi-Fi use, remote work, online banking, shopping, payments, or access to important accounts—the value becomes much easier to understand.
